Différences
Ci-dessous, les différences entre deux révisions de la page.
| Les deux révisions précédentesRévision précédenteProchaine révision | Révision précédente | ||
| linux:custom_mint_cinnamon_21 [2025/07/12 12:35] – maj md5sum policies.json minimi | linux:custom_mint_cinnamon_21 [2026/02/07 03:03] (Version actuelle) – [AUTOMATISATION SCRIPT] minimi | ||
|---|---|---|---|
| Ligne 426: | Ligne 426: | ||
| <file bash upgrade_mint.sh> | <file bash upgrade_mint.sh> | ||
| - | #!/bin/bash | ||
| - | |||
| function yes_or_no { | function yes_or_no { | ||
| while true; do | while true; do | ||
| Ligne 437: | Ligne 435: | ||
| done | done | ||
| } | } | ||
| - | + | ||
| - | + | ||
| - | + | ||
| echo "[ Pavé Numérique ] Le PC possède t’il un pavé numérique ?" | echo "[ Pavé Numérique ] Le PC possède t’il un pavé numérique ?" | ||
| - | echo "pavé numérique ?" | + | |
| - | install_numlockx="" | + | install_numlockx=" |
| + | yes_or_no | ||
| + | |||
| + | if [ $? -eq 0 ] | ||
| + | then | ||
| + | | ||
| + | fi | ||
| + | |||
| + | |||
| + | echo "[ Parametre de bases ] Valider pour mettre en place les paramètres suivants : | ||
| + | - Suppression des options d' | ||
| + | - Supprimer flatpak | ||
| + | - Supprimer Snap | ||
| + | - Desactiver verrouillage ecran" | ||
| yes_or_no | yes_or_no | ||
| - | + | ||
| if [ $? -eq 0 ] | if [ $? -eq 0 ] | ||
| then | then | ||
| | | ||
| - | fi | + | |
| - | + | | |
| - | echo "[ Accessibilité ] Supprimer les options d' | + | |
| - | echo " notamment pour éviter l' | + | |
| - | echo "" | + | else |
| - | suppr_accessibility=y | + | echo "[ Accessibilité ] Supprimer les options d' |
| - | yes_or_no | + | echo " notamment pour éviter l' |
| - | + | echo "" | |
| - | if [ $? -eq 1 ] | + | suppr_accessibility=y |
| - | then | + | yes_or_no |
| - | | + | |
| - | fi | + | if [ $? -eq 1 ] |
| - | + | then | |
| - | echo "[ Flatpak ] Supprimer le support flatpak ?" | + | |
| - | echo " Pour un utilisateur lambda supprime les paquets flatpak & gir1.2-flatpak-1.0" | + | fi |
| - | echo "" | + | |
| - | suppr_flatpak=y | + | echo "[ Flatpak ] Supprimer le support flatpak ?" |
| - | yes_or_no | + | echo " Pour un utilisateur lambda supprime les paquets flatpak & gir1.2-flatpak-1.0" |
| - | + | echo "" | |
| - | if [ $? -eq 1 ] | + | suppr_flatpak=y |
| - | then | + | yes_or_no |
| - | | + | |
| - | fi | + | if [ $? -eq 1 ] |
| + | then | ||
| + | | ||
| + | fi | ||
| + | |||
| + | echo "[ Snap ] Activer Snap ?" | ||
| + | echo " Utile pour skype, Chromium sur 22.1 xia linuxmint est en deb" | ||
| + | echo " Déplace / | ||
| + | echo "" | ||
| + | active_snap=n | ||
| + | list_snap="" | ||
| + | yes_or_no | ||
| + | |||
| + | if [ $? -eq 0 ] | ||
| + | then | ||
| + | | ||
| + | | ||
| + | fi | ||
| + | |||
| + | |||
| + | # | ||
| + | # TODO désactivation lock screen | ||
| + | # org.cinnamon.desktop.screensaver lock-enabled true | ||
| + | # org.cinnamon.settings-daemon.plugins.power lock-on-suspend false | ||
| + | |||
| + | echo "[ Verrouillage veille ] Désactiver le verrouillage de l’écran ?" | ||
| + | disablelock=false | ||
| + | yes_or_no | ||
| + | |||
| + | if [ $? -eq 0 ] | ||
| + | then | ||
| + | disablelock=true | ||
| + | else | ||
| + | disablelock=false | ||
| - | echo "[ Snap ] Activer Snap ?" | + | |
| - | echo " Utile pour skype, Chromium sur 22.1 xia linuxmint est en deb" | + | |
| - | echo " Déplace / | + | |
| - | echo "" | + | |
| - | active_snap=n | + | |
| - | list_snap="" | + | |
| - | yes_or_no | + | |
| - | + | ||
| - | if [ $? -eq 0 ] | + | |
| - | then | + | |
| - | | + | |
| - | | + | |
| fi | fi | ||
| - | + | if [ $disablelock | |
| - | # | + | |
| - | # TODO désactivation lock screen | + | |
| - | # org.cinnamon.desktop.screensaver lock-enabled true | + | |
| - | # org.cinnamon.settings-daemon.plugins.power lock-on-suspend false | + | |
| - | + | ||
| - | echo "[ Verrouillage veille ] Désactiver le verrouillage de l’écran ?" | + | |
| - | disablelock="" | + | |
| - | yes_or_no | + | |
| - | + | ||
| - | if [ $? -eq 0 ] | + | |
| then | then | ||
| - | gsettings set org.cinnamon.desktop.screensaver lock-enabled false | + | |
| - | gsettings set org.cinnamon.settings-daemon.plugins.power lock-on-suspend false | + | |
| + | else | ||
| + | echo gsettings set org.cinnamon.desktop.screensaver lock-enabled true | ||
| + | echo gsettings set org.cinnamon.settings-daemon.plugins.power lock-on-suspend true | ||
| fi | fi | ||
| + | sudo echo "[ Tache d' | ||
| # echo " Ajout des raccourcis clavier pour le passage AZERTY <-> BÉPO - QWERTY -> BÉPO" | # echo " Ajout des raccourcis clavier pour le passage AZERTY <-> BÉPO - QWERTY -> BÉPO" | ||
| Ligne 540: | Ligne 565: | ||
| echo "[ Cinnamon ] changement fond d' | echo "[ Cinnamon ] changement fond d' | ||
| - | backgroundCurrent=$(settings | + | backgroundCurrent=$(gsettings |
| codename=$(lsb_release -cs ) | codename=$(lsb_release -cs ) | ||
| release=$(lsb_release -rs | sed -e ' | release=$(lsb_release -rs | sed -e ' | ||
| Ligne 547: | Ligne 572: | ||
| case $release in | case $release in | ||
| 22 ) | 22 ) | ||
| - | gsettings set org.cinnamon.desktop.background picture-uri ' | + | |
| + | then | ||
| + | gsettings set org.cinnamon.desktop.background picture-uri ' | ||
| + | else | ||
| + | | ||
| + | fi | ||
| + | | ||
| 21 ) | 21 ) | ||
| gsettings set org.cinnamon.desktop.background picture-uri ' | gsettings set org.cinnamon.desktop.background picture-uri ' | ||